Wangxin Yu is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Artificial Intelligence and Economics and Econometrics. According to data from OpenAlex, Wangxin Yu has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 2 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 2 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 2 papers in Economics and Econometrics. Recurrent topics in Wangxin Yu's work include Neural Networks and Applications (2 papers), Face and Expression Recognition (2 papers) and Face recognition and analysis (2 papers). Wangxin Yu is often cited by papers focused on Neural Networks and Applications (2 papers), Face and Expression Recognition (2 papers) and Face recognition and analysis (2 papers). Wangxin Yu collaborates with scholars based in China. Wangxin Yu's co-authors include Weiting Chen, Zhizhong Wang, Hong-Bo Xie, Jun Zhuang, Zhizhong Wang, Wei-Ting Chen, Zhiguang Wang, Guitao Cao, Weiting Chen and Ying Zhou and has published in prestigious journals such as Neurocomputing, IEEE Transactions on Neural Systems and Rehabilitation Engineering and Neural Computing and Applications.
